A highlight in the suspension area is the BMW M Performance limited-slip differential available for the BMW M235i Coupé. When the dynamic stability control function DSC is deactivated, the torque-sensitive mechanical limited-slip differential in the rear axle ensures traction-optimised distribution of drive torque between the rear wheels. It reduces the slip that occurs on the wheel with less grip by transferring more drive power to the other wheels using a blocking effect. This converts engine power into forward momentum as effectively as possible so as to be able to accelerate out of a bend even more dynamically, for instance.

Engineered to take on the most challenging off-road trails, Jeep Wrangler Polar is equipped with the Dana 30 front axle and powerful Dana 44 rear axle. Legendary Wrangler capability is achieved through the standard Command-Trac NV241 part-time, two-speed transfer case with a 2.72:1 low-range gear ratio. In order to handle any off-road track in utmost safety, the new Wrangler Polar model comes standard with the Trac-Lok anti-spin rear differential. This particular differential replaces the manual rear-axle locker and is a torque-sensitive mechanical unit that works to maintain traction when travelling on slippery or rough road surfaces, such as on sand, gravel, snow or ice. Trac-Lok automatically distributes the available torque to the rear wheel with the most traction, thus helping to reduce wheel spin caused by lack of traction in the other rear wheel.

At the Volkswagen company, the letters "GTI" have stood for superior dynamic performance for over three decades now. In the tradition of previous models by the same name, Volkswagen has introduced the latest version of the Volkswagen Golf GTI at the 2013 Geneva International Motor Show. For the first time, the legendary compact sports car is available at two power levels: the standard 220 PS or the GTI Performance with 230 PS and front axle differential lock.

The new GTI is powered by a turbocharged petrol direct-injection engine (TSI) with 162 kW / 220 PS. For the first time in the history of the sports car icon, a special GTI Performance will be offered. In this version, the engine's maximum power is boosted to 169 kW / 230 PS. Both GTI versions develop a maximum torque of 350 Nm. The standard GTI accelerates to 100 km/h in 6.5 seconds and reaches a top speed of 246 km/h. The GTI Performance reaches a top speed of 250 km/h and just 6.4 seconds for the sprint to 100 km/h.

Both GTI versions are equipped with a Stop-Start system, they fulfil the EU-6 emissions standard that takes effect in 2014 and - with a 6-speed gearbox - they attain the same low DIN fuel consumption value of 6.0 l/100 km (CO2: 139 g/km). This means that the Golf GTI offers an 18 per cent improvement in fuel economy compared to the previous model. With the optional 6-speed DSG, the two GTI cars consume 6.4 and 6.5 l/100 respectively (equivalent to 148 and 150 g/km CO2).

More dynamic proportions
Compared to the previous model, the wheelbase was extended 53 mm to 2,631 mm, but at the same time the front overhang was shortened 12 mm. In parallel, the A-pillar "wandered" further towards the rear, which makes the bonnet longer and visually shifts the entire vehicle cabin rearwards. This "cab-backward effect" makes the GTI more of a premium class car than a compact class car. In addition, the height of the GTI was reduced 27 mm to 1,442 mm. The car's length grew 55 mm to 4,268 mm now, and the width grew 13 mm to 1,799 mm. Many values that add up to an important result: the proportions of the new Golf GTI made unmistakable gains in dynamics.

Powertrain - TSI engines
The Golf GTI VII is powered by an advanced engine of the EA888 series - a two-litre turbocharged direct-injection petrol engine (TSI) with a new cylinder head design. The TSI produces 162 kW / 220 PS (from 4,500 to 6,200 rpm). The sports car icon is optionally available in a performance-enhanced version as the Golf GTI Performance. In this version, the engine produces 169 kW / 230 PS (from 4,700 to 6,200 rpm). Both GTI versions are equipped with a Stop/Start system as standard and, with a 6-speed gearbox, they attain the same low NEDC fuel consumption of 6.0 l/100 km (CO2: 139 g/km). The combined fuel consumption of the new Volkswagen Golf GTI was thereby reduced by 1.3 litres per 100 km, or 18 per cent, compared to the previous model (155 kW / 210 PS). A 6-speed dual-clutch gearbox (DSG) is available as an option for both power levels. The recognised high agility of the Golf GTI has been increased once again in the new model compared to the previous model. In two stages:
    Stage 1 - the standard GTI: The 220 PS base version now outputs 10 PS more than the previous model. At the same time, its maximum torque was increased by a considerable 70 Nm to 350 Nm (from 1,500 to 4,400 rpm). Equipped in this way, the Golf GTI makes its appearance with highly superior flexibility values: in fourth gear, the Golf GTI accelerates from 80 to 120 km/h in 5.0 seconds; in fifth gear, it takes 6.0 seconds. Other data that must not be overlooked in a GTI: the new one accelerates to 100 km/h in 6.5 seconds and reaches a top speed of 246 km/h.
    Stage 2 - the GTI Performance: Those choosing a Golf GTI with the performance pack ignite the second stage. As mentioned, the car's power is increased by 10 PS here, while its maximum torque is identical. The 230 PS of power enables a top speed of 250 km/h and just 6.4 seconds for the sprint to 100 km/h. Its maximum torque of 350 Nm is available from 1,500 to 4,600 rpm.

SVT Raptor prowess and power
Since launching as a 2010 model, the Ford F-150 SVT Raptor has set the benchmark for low- and high-speed off-road performance through aggressive all-terrain tires, industry-exclusive internal triple-bypass FOX Racing Shox™ dampers, skid plates and standard Hill Descent Control™.

A Raptor development imperative has been continuous improvement, so Ford expanded Raptor's footprint for 2011 with a four-door Super Crew model joining the two-door Super Cab original.

For 2012 Ford began offering a grille-mounted camera to improve driver visibility when climbing over rocks or other obstacles. The 2012 addition of a Torsen limited-slip differential to Raptor's 4WD system enables the truck to balance traction between both front wheels.

For 2013 industry-exclusive beadlock-capable wheels were added to help increase grip in low-traction conditions, along with high-intensity discharge headlamps for improved visibility. SYNC® with MyFord Touch® was also made available for added connectivity.

SVT Raptor is available exclusively with a 6.2-liter V8 engine producing best-in-class 411 horsepower and 434 lb.-ft. of torque, mated to an electronic six-speed automatic transmission with tow/haul mode and Select Shift Automatic functionality. The 4WD system features electronic shift-on-the-fly capability for the transfer case.

The front axle features a Torsen differential with 4.10 to 1 gearing. The rear axle is also 4.10 to 1, with an electronic-locking differential.

An award-winning high-performance engine, the 2.5 TFSI, is at work under the hood of the Audi RS Q3. This five-cylinder engine has been named "International Engine of the Year" in its class for three consecutive years since 2010 by an international jury of automotive specialists. From 2,480 cc of engine displacement, the turbocharged direct-injection engine produces a maximum power of 228 kW (310 hp) at 5,200-6,700 rpm; its maximum torque of 420 Nm (309.78 lb-ft) is available between 1,500 and 5,200 rpm. These two values signify that the RS Q3 is unrivaled in its competitive field. This five-cylinder is a special engine, beginning with its fundamental concept. It is familiar from the TT RS and RS3 Sportback, and quattro GmbH modified it for use in the RS Q3.

The 1-2-4-5-3 ignition sequence, supported by the geometry of the air induction and exhaust systems, generates a sporty engine sound that first made Audi popular back in the 1980s.

Drivers can influence the flap control for the exhaust system and the accelerator characteristic by choosing one of the modes auto, comfort and dynamic using the standard Audi drive select system. In the dynamic mode, engine response is sharper and the engine sound more intensive.

The 2.5 TFSI accelerates the Audi RS Q3 from a standstill to 100 km/h (62.14 mph) in just 5.5 seconds - the best performance value in this segment. The vehicle's top speed is electronically limited to 250 km/h (155.34 mph). In the RS Q3, the Audi five-cylinder engine is working together with a standard start-stop-system for the first time. Other efficiency measures such as a regulated oil pump, which only pumps lubricant when needed, contribute to the car's low average fuel consumption of 8.8 liters of fuel per 100 km (26.73 US mpg) which equates to 206 grams CO2 per km (331.52 g/mile).

A standard seven-speed S tronic transfers power to the drivetrain. It was designed in a compact three-shaft configuration, and its seventh gear has a long gear ratio to save on fuel. Drivers can choose between the D and S modes for automatic shifting of the dual clutch transmission, or they can shift manually - using the shift paddles on the steering wheel or the selector lever that sports a unique RS design. The Launch Control function controls acceleration from a standstill to attain optimal traction.

The heart of the quattro permanent all-wheel drive system is the hydraulically operated and electronically controlled multi-plate clutch located at the rear axle. It ensures proper distribution of torque between the front and rear axles.

GHIBLI S V6 ENGINE
The most powerful version of the Ghibli's 2987 cc V6 shares much of its technology with the Quattroporte's flagship 3.8-litre V8 engine.

With 301 kW (410hp) of power at 5500 rpm, the downsized V6 TwinTurbo delivers big V8 performance with 550 Nm of torque between 4500 rpm and 5000 rpm.

The V6's maximum engine speed of 6500 rpm, yet it delivers 90 percent of its 550 Nm of torque from 1600 rpm and its specific torque is actually higher than the V8's, at 183 Nm per litre. It also has an overboost function that is capable of providing the engine's maximum boost between 1750 rpm and 5000 rpm.

It uses the V8's petrol direct injection technology, cylinder architecture and combustion technology along with two low-inertia parallel turbochargers and four continuous camshaft phasers. It uses high-pressure fuel injection to deliver its fuel at around 200 bars of pressure.

The Maserati Ghibli S accelerates to 100 km/h in 5.0 seconds, a tenth of a second faster to 100 km/h than the corresponding Quattroporte S.

It has a top speed of 285 km/h (177mph) top speed almost matching the Quattroporte S.

The engine is also efficient, given its powerful performance numbers. The Ghibli S posts 10.4 (27.2mpg) on the NEDCcombined cycle.

The Ghibli S emits 242 grams of CO2/km.

The V6 engine's parallel turbochargers are slightly different to the twin-scroll units on the V8, but it retains the V8's core dimensions with its bore measurement unchanged at 86.5 mm.

It uses high-tumble cylinder heads and two continuous cam phasers for each cylinder head; it can advance or retard the inlet and exhaust valve timing independently in real time four-phase variators for optimal combustion control for high performance and low consumption.

Another characteristic feature of the new Maserati engine family is the 200 bar direct fuel-injection system. This very high pressure helps atomise the fuel, thus improving the fuel-air mixture and optimising combustion at higher engine speeds.

The Maserati Ghibli S has two intercoolers - one to feed each of the turbo chargers -mounted low on either side of the main radiator to catch a constant supply of fresh, cool air.

The engine also uses a state-of-the-art ECU, with integral high-speed processors, which handle an array of shifting functions in real time.

Maserati Powertrain has also switched to on-demand ancillaries, with a variable displacement oil pump that works under electrical control for improved consumption and performance.

It also uses an innovative, computer control of the alternator, which monitors the vehicle's electricity consumption and manages the alternator's workload to suit.

The engine also operates in both Normal and Sport modes, along with Manual versions of either mode, operated by elongated shift paddles fixed to the steering column.

The new Maserati Ghibli also makes available the I.C.E. (Increased Control and Efficiency) strategy, a function aimed at reducing consumption, emissions and noise. This is a user-select strategy that delivers a softer throttle pedal response for smooth driving, cancels the turbocharger's over-boost function and keeps the exhaust's Sport flaps closed until 5000 rpm. It also adjusts the gear changes to make them softer and slower and reduces torque at each gear's take-up point.

Like the Quattroporte's engine family, the Ghibli V6 engines were developed by Maserati Powertrain, in partnership with Ferrari Powertrain, and will be built by Ferrari in its world-leading engine construction facility in Maranello.

TRANSMISSION
All versions of the Maserati Ghibli are fitted with the same ZF AT8 - HP70 eight-speed automatic transmission that has already proven itself in the new Quattroporte.

The transmission delivers in every parameter, from comfort to fast gear shifting, and from minimised fuel consumption to low NVH (Noise, Vibration and Harshness).

As befitting Maserati tradition, it is capable of being in five dedicated shift modes: Auto Normal, Auto Sport, Manual Normal, Manual Sport and the extreme weather I.C.E mode.

Auto Normal is the Ghibli 's default setting and performs its gear changes with fluid shifts at low engine speeds to emphasise the car's comfort and to minimise fuel consumption.

The Auto Sport mode sees the transmission switch character to change gears with greater alacrity at higher engine speeds and deliver a distinct gear engagement to enhance the powertrain's sporting feel.

In both of these modes, the car recognises a variety of conditions, such as whether the car is travelling up or down hill, is braking hard or is driving through a corner, and selects the best gear and the best gear-shift style accordingly.

The transmission can also be controlled manually by selecting the M button on the transmission tunnel.

In Manual Normal mode, the driver can change gear with either the elongated gearshift paddles attached to the steering column or by using the transmission lever. The driver is in charge of the gear selection, though the system will intervene and change to a lower gear if the engine revs drop too low, or change to a higher gear if the engine revs climb too high.

In Manual Sport mode, however, the gearshifts are at their fastest and crispest, giving the driver full control of the powertrain. The system will not intervene, even if the driver strikes the engine's rev limiter. It will only intervene if the engine's revs drop too low to be effective in a given gear.

The I.C.E (Increased Control Efficiency) mode is designed for remarkable fuel economy, relaxed driving and extremely low grip conditions. The transmission changes gear as softly as possible, both going up through the gears and returning back down.

All gearshift modes can be selected via buttons on the left of the gear knob.

LIMITED-SLIP DIFFERENTIAL
As has become expected of Maserati, the Ghibli also utilises a mechanical limited-slip rear differential as well, in both its rear- and all-wheel drive versions.

The Ghibli is the only car in its class to use a standard mechanical limited slip differential in all its versions in order to deliver the best inherent traction in all driving situations.

The bevel-drive, asymmetric unit offers 35 percent lock-up under power and 45 percent under release.

The rear differential is driven via a two-piece, 80 mm-thick light-weight steel prop shaft with two constant velocity joints and a head rubber coupling, which runs through a cross member-mounted rubber bearing for lower NVH levels without compromising rigidity.

SUSPENSION
Double wishbone suspension layouts are a race-bred tradition at Maserati and the Ghibli continues with this heritage but also incorporates some new technologies for greater accuracy.

Utilising a suspension layout and software system that has already proven a hit in the Quattroporte, the Ghibli has high-mounted all-aluminium double wishbones at the front to guarantee light and precise handling characteristics.

Aluminium is the dominant metal of the front suspension system, with the dome nuts, the hub carrier bars and uprights all made from forged aluminium, while the springs are steel. This matches up to constantly adaptive Skyhook dampers and an anti-roll bar.

The geometry of the system has delivered a quadrilateral architecture, which has enabled Maserati's handling team to deliver steering that is precise, communicative and comfortable.

The rear suspension employs a firmer version of the Quattroporte's five-bar multi-link system, with four aluminium suspension arms, and has achieved the conflicting targets of executive ride comfort and extreme sports performance.

The Ghibli's suspension package is based around a fixed rate damping system to control the movement of its steel springs and anti-roll bars.

All Ghiblis are available with the option of the Skyhook adaptive damping system, where all four Skyhook dampers can now be electronically controlled independent of each other. This is a variation of the Quattroporte's standard system, though its performance and tuning has been heavily modified to cater for the Maserati Ghibli's more dynamic ethos.

The default mode for the optional Skyhook system prioritises comfort, and then becomes more athletic if the driver presses the suspension button. This extra damping stiffness pushes the Ghibli's handling to even higher levels and its tune was developed in both extreme test scenarios and on the racetrack. Essentially, it drastically reduces both longitudinal and lateral load transfers and minimises body roll to bring out the sportiest side of the car's character.

The computer system in control of the Skyhook dampers monitors an enormous array of parameters, including speed and lateral and longitudinal acceleration, individual wheel movements, body movement and damper dynamics.

Adjusting also to suit the suspension mode chosen by the driver, the system delivers the perfect damping mode for each wheel almost instantly.

Late this year, the Ghibli Diesel will be available with the option of a Sports suspension setup, which will be based around the fixed damping system rather than the optional Skyhook system.

While the architecture of the Sport suspension is unchanged, it lowers the ride height by 10 mm and uses stiffer springs and firmer, dual-rate Koni dampers that adjust to varying conditions. This is available only on these two models to counteract their slightly heavier front weight distribution (51 : 49).
